Changed defaults in Splitfork, our assignment service. Bucketing now uses sticky hashing per account instead of per session, and the holdout slice grew from 2% to 5%. Callers relying on session-level reassignment must opt in explicitly. Review the diff against the new baseline; the updated default configuration is listed below.

config for tagep-kajof:
[casir]
port = 6379
region = south-1
host = casir.paliqdyn.example
team = tamax
timeout_ms = 250
retries = 2

**Action item 4 — circuit breaker defaults for the Ferndale upstream**

During the outage, every plugin that called the Ferndale quote API hammered it with retries, which kept the upstream pinned at the floor. We're shipping a shared circuit breaker in the Opalrock SDK so plugin authors don't each roll their own. If you currently retry manually, please remove that logic and let the breaker do its thing — stacked retries defeat the half-open probe. Your plugin can override thresholds, but the SDK ships with the following defaults.

constants for bawif-kawif:
QUOTAS = {
    "ulaael": 5,
    "holael": 10,
}

// Crash-report pipeline constants (Pebblewing ingest tier).
// Reports arrive from the Lanternfall mobile SDK in gzipped batches;
// we debounce duplicate stack hashes before forwarding to triage.
// Reviewers: the retry window must stay shorter than the SDK's
// client-side resend interval or we double-count crashes. Queue
// depth caps were sized against the worst spike we saw during the
// Marrowgate launch. Do not raise batch size without re-running the
// dedupe soak test. The tuning constants are defined immediately below.

constants for kawef-bawif:
TIERS = {
    "oliir": 236,
    "lamion": 438,
    "pelmir": 279,
}

**Runbook: soft deletes in the orders table**

Orders in Pellworth Commerce are never hard-deleted. Setting the deleted flag hides rows from storefront queries but keeps them for reconciliation. Always use the retire script, never raw updates, so the audit trigger fires. When escalating a mismatch, include the service build shown below.

build token for tawip-yageg: htk9_92ac43d42